New spin quantum battery can be charged without an external field

Phys.org  November 30, 2024 Researchers in Italy investigated the performance of a one-dimensional dimerized chain as a spin quantum battery. Integrable model showed a rich quantum phase diagram that emerged through a mapping of the spins onto auxiliary fermionic degrees of freedom. They used a charging protocol relying on the double quench of an internal parameter, the strength of the dimerization, and addressed the energy stored in the systems.
